Phone for best price

Article Type: News From: International Journal of Productivity and Performance Management, Volume 59, Issue 8

The first ever paper to look at the impact (in India) of farm information-enabled mobile telephony on small farmers has concluded that while it has begun to enhance agricultural productivity at different levels, it needs significant improvements in order to achieve full productivity-enhancing potential.

Erratic services and irrelevant information dominate at present, instead. Among the states studied (the relevant services are not available countrywide yet), small farmers from Maharashtra (income between Rs 12-17,000/month) reported the highest use of their phones to access information, leading to diverse benefits.

These included yield improvements, price realisation and better adjustment of supply to market demand.
